Russia and China Catch Security Council in a Devastating Lie

Russia – Insider | March 25, 2017 Russia and China have teamed up once again in the U.N. Security Council — and this time they called a rather embarrassing bluff. On Friday, Moscow and Beijing proposed that a United Nations panel investigating chemical weapons use in Syria be extended to Iraq, a proposal that was […]
